Dr. David Barrall, MD is a plastic surgeon in Providence, RI and has over 40 years of experience in the medical field. He graduated from Brown University Alpert Medical School in 1981. He is affiliated with medical facilities such as Kent County Memorial Hospital and Roger Williams Medical Center. He is accepting new patients.

Went to Massachusetts over the Christmas holiday in 2019. Got a splinter in my hand which I got a very bad infection and blood poisoning from the splinter entering the sheeth area on the palm. Not only did Dr. Barrall save my hand, he saved my life! He is very kind, caring and concerned about each patient. He even gave me his cell # and had me call or text with any concerns or questions and wanted to see photos of the wound to ensure it was healing properly after being released from the hospital. I have never in my life experienced a truly caring Physician. He has excellent bedside manor and is very thorough. You will not be disappointed with trusting Dr. Barrall for caring for you. I will always remember him and forever be thankful he saved my hand and my life ?

Dr. Barrall was my emergency room surgeon, called in while out walking his dog on a late Saturday in February, when I did significant lip and face damage in an ice fall. Professional, calming, confident, empathetic, appropriately humorous, and extraordinarily skilled. I was hoping that the damage I did would be reasonably repairable, with minimal scarring. What I ended up with was remarkable. Friends and family in (and outside of) the medical field were amazed with his work, as am I. My follow-up appointment was fast and easy, with no issues or concerns. I hope I - and you - never need professional services like his again, but without a doubt he's the only one on my request list. Highly, highly recommended, thank you Dr. Barrall!
